No Trust-worthy Commitment For Talks: Dahal

UCPN (Maoist) Chairman Pushpa Kamal Dahal has said that the process for talks could not move ahead as Prime Minister Sushil Koirala has not expressed any commitment of stopping the majority process even if he called the opposition alliance for talks twice.

Addressing a cadres´ training organized in Lalitpur Tuesday, Dahal stressed that the Nepali Congress and CPN-UML have to show the activeness as shown by the Prime Minister for talks reports My Republica online.

He said they were ready for talks if the ruling parties express trust-worthy commitment to forward the constitution writing process through consensus by stopping the majority process.

Stating the agitation was their compulsion, Chairman Dahal expressed the view that the statement of the ruling parties of not implementing the previous agreements was not in favour of the country and people.
